Once upon a time, there lived a mother and her daughter in a small village, in Borneo
island. The daughter was so beautiful, but she had a very bad behavior. She never helped her
mother to work. She just spent her time in front of the mirror to beautify herself and to
admire her beauty. While her mother had to work to fulfill their daily needs. She was also a
spoiled girl. She always asked everything to her mother. if her mother didn’t fulfill her want,
she would cry. This made her mother so sad, but somehow she still loved her daughter. So
she always tried to fulfill what her daughter wanted.
One day, the girl forced her mother to buy a new gown for her. At first, her mother
refused her request. She told her daughter that she didn’t have enough money. But her
daughter threatened her mother, then she fulfilled to but a new gown. Before going to the
market together, her daughter reminded her mom,”Let’s go shopping, but I don’t want to
walk beside you. You had to walk behind me, I felt embarrassed if people see me”. Even
though her mother felt really sad, she obeyed her daughter request, she did not want her
daughter feel embarrassed.
The daughter dressed beautifully while her mother wore very simple dress. Even
though they were a mother and a daughter, they looked so different. Her mother looked like
her servant. In the middle of their way to market, a man greeted them,”Hi cute girl, is she
your mother?”. he asked. “How could you think that? Of course she is not my mother, she is
my servant”, the daughter replied. Her mother was so sad to hear that. She kept silent though
her heart was crying aloud. Along the street everyone passing kept asking the girl about her
mother. And the girl always told them that the old woman behind her was her servant.
The mother had stayed patiently along the street. And finally she could not bear it to hear her
daughter’s answer. she prayed to the God,”O Lord, punish my ungrateful daughter, please!”,
she prayed. Suddenly the girl’s legs turned to be a stone immediately after the mother stopped
praying. The change came slowly. Knowing her legs turned to be a stone, the daughter
screamed.”What’s happen to my legs?”. Then she realized that she had hurt her mother’s
feeling. She cried and begged for absolution to her mother.”Mommy, Forgive me please,
mom”. She begged. The daughter kept crying. But it was too late. The whole body eventually
became a stone. The mother actually felt so sad to see her daughter. But she could not do
anything to the God’s destiny. Even though she had become a stone completely, people can
still see her tears. That is the reason why it was called Batu Menangis.
Cerita rakyat batu menangis
Pada zaman dahulu, hiduplah seorang ibu dan putrinya di sebuah desa kecil, di pulau
Kalimantan. Putrinya sangat cantik, namun ia memiliki sifat yang sangat buruk. Dia tidak
pernah membantu ibunya bekerja. Dia hanya menghabiskan waktunya di depan cermin untuk
mempercantik dirinya dan mengagumi kecantikannya. Sementara ibunya harus bekerja untuk
memenuhi kebutuhan sehari-hari. Dia juga seorang gadis yang manja. Dia selalu meminta
segala sesuatu kepada ibunya. Jika ibunya tidak memenuhi keinginannya, dia akan menangis.
Tentu ini membuat sang ibu sangat sedih, tapi biar bagaimana ibunya masih mencintai
putrinya. Jadi sang ibu selalu mencoba untuk memenuhi apa yang inginkan putrinya.
Suatu hari, gadis memaksa ibunya untuk membelikan gaun baru untuknya. Pada
awalnya, sang ibu menolak permintaannya. sang ibu mengatakan kepada anaknya bahwa ia
tidak mempunyai cukup uang. Tapi putrinya mengancam, maka Ibunya memenuhi untuk
membeli gaun baru. Sebelum pergi ke pasar bersama-sama, putrinya mengingatkan pada
ibunya, “Ayo kita pergi berbelanja bersama. Tetapi aku tidak ingin berjalan di sampingmu.
Ibu harus berjalan di belakangku, aku merasa malu jika orang melihatku”. Meskipun ibunya
merasa benar-benar sedih, sang ibu tetap memenuhi permintaannya putri, ia tidak mengingin
kanputri merasa malu.
Putrinya berpakaian sangat cantik sementara ibunya mengenakan gaun yang sangat
sederhana. Meskipun mereka adalah ibu dan anak, mereka tampak begitu berbeda. Ibunya
lebih tampak seperti pembantunya. Di tengah jalan ke pasar, seorang pria menyapamereka,
“gadis cantik, apakah dia ibumu?”. ia bertanya. “Bagaimana bisa Anda berpikir seperti itu?
Tentu saja dia bukanlah ibuku, dia adalah pembantuku”, putri itu menjawab. Ibunya sangat
sedih mendengarnya. Dia tetap diam meskipun hatinya menangis sangat keras. Sepanjang
jalan, semua orang yang melewati terus bertanya kepada putri tersebut tentang ibunya. Dan
putrinya selalu memberitahu mereka bahwa wanita tua di belakangnya adalah pembantunya.
Ibu telah bersabar sepanjang jalan. Dan akhirnya sang ibu tidak tahan lagi mendengar
jawaban putrinya. Dia berdoa kepada Tuhan, “Ya Tuhan, hukumlah putri saya tidak tahu
berterima kasih ini!”, doa sang ibu. Tiba-tiba kaki putrinya itu berubah menjadi batu seketika
setelah ibu berhenti berdoa. Perubahan terjadi secara perlahan-lahan. Mengetahui kakinya
berubah menjadi batu, putrinya pun berteriak.”Apa yang terjadi pada kakiku? “. Kemudian
dia menyadari bahwa dia telah menyakiti perasaan ibunya. Dia menangis dan memohon
untuk pengampunan kepada ibunya.”Ibu, ampuni saya, ibu “. Dia memohon. Putrinya terus
menangis. Tapi semua itu sudah terlambat. Seluruh tubuh akhirnya menjadi batu. Ibu benar-
benar merasa sangat sedih menyaksikan putrinya berubah menjadi batu. Tapi sang ibu tidak
bisa melakukan apa-apa lagi atas kehendak Tuhan. Meskipun sang putri telah menjadi batu,
orang masih bisa melihat mata airnya mengalir. Itulah alasan mengapa ia disebut Batu
Menangis.
Lagenda Tangkuban Perahu
Once upon a time in west Java, Indonesia lived a wise king who had a beautiful
daughter. Her name was Dayang Sumbi. She liked weaving very much. Once she was
weaving a cloth when one of her tool fell to the ground. She was very tired at the time so she
was too lazy to take it. Then she just shouted outloud.
‘Anybody there? Bring me my tool. I will give you special present. If you are female, I will
consider you as my sister. If you are male, I will marry you
Suddenly a male dog, its name was Tumang, came. He brought her the falling tool.
Dayang Sumbi was very surprised. She regretted her words but she could not deny it. So she
had to marry Tumang and leave her father. Then they lived in a small village. Several
months later they had a son. His name was Sangkuriang. He was a handsome and healthy
boy.
Sangkuriang liked hunting very much. He often went hunting to the wood using his
arrow. When he went hunting Tumang always with him. In the past there were many deer in
Java so Sangkuriang often hunted for deer.
One day Dayang Sumbi wanted to have deer’s heart so she asked Sangkuriang to
hunt for a deer. Then Sangkuriang went to the wood with his arrow and his faithful dog
Tumang. But after several days in the wood Sangkuriang could not find any deer. They were
all disappeared. Sangkuriang was exhausted and desperate. He did not want to disappoint
her mother so he killed Tumang. He did not know that Tumang was his father. At home he
gave Tumang’s heart to her mother.
But Dayang Sumbi knew that it was Tumang’s heart. She was so angry that she could
not control her emotion. She hit Sangkuriang at his head. Sangkuriang was wounded. There
was a scar in his head. She also repelled her son. Sangkuriang left her mother in sadness.
Many years passed and Sangkuriang became a strong young man. He wandered
everywhere. One day he arrived at his own village but he did not realized it. There he met
Dayang Sumbi. At the time Dayang Sumbi was given an eternal beauty by God so she stayed
young forever. Both of them did not know each other. So they fell in love and then they
decided to marry.
But then Dayang Sumbi recognized a scar on his Sangkuriang’s head. She knew that
Sangkuriang was his son. It was impossible for them to marry. She told him but he did not
believe her. He wished that they marry soon. So Dayang Sumbi gave a very difficult
condition. She wanted Sangkuriang to build a lake and a boat in one night! She said she
needed that for honeymoon.
Sangkuriang agreed. With the help of genie and spirits Sangkuriang tried to build
them. By midnight he had finished the lake by building a dam in Citarum river. Then he
started building the boat. It was almost dawn when he nearly finished it. Meanwhile Dayang
Sumbi kept watching on them. She was very worried when she knew this. So she made
lights in the east. Then the spirits thought that it was already dawn. It was time for them to
leave. They left Sangkuriang alone. Without their help he could not finish the boat.
Sangkuriang was very angry. He kicked the boat. Then the boat turned out to be Mount
Tangkuban Perahu. It means boat upside down. From a distant it looks like a boat upside
down.
